K3 NaK filled Melt pressure transmitters
Features
- The K3 Series are for use in high temperature applications where the process temperatures may reach 538°C(1000°F) such as high temperature engineered polymers.
- The K Series utilizes standard melt pressure principles and construction, but uses a near incompressible NAK(Sodium Potassium) for pressure transmission.
- The K Series strain sensing technology is bonded foil strain gage.
- Pressure ranges from: 0-35 to 0-1000 bar / 0-500 to 0-15000 psi
- Accuracy < ±0.25% FSO (H); < ±0.5% FSO (M)
- Hydraulic transmission system for pressure signal guarantees stability at working temperature (NaK). Liquid conforming to RoHS Directive. NaK is defined as a safe substance (GRAS)
- 1/2-20UNF, M18x1.5 standard threads; other types available on request
- Inconel 718 diaphragm with GTP coating for temperatures up to 538°C (1000°F)
- 15-5 PH diaphragm with GTP coating for temperatures up to 400°C (750°F)
- Hastelloy C276 diaphragm for temperatures up to 300°C (570°F)
- 17-7 PH corrugated diaphragm with GTP coating for ranges below 100bar-1500psi
